The full press release from the city follows.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p class = &quot;hr&quot;&gt;&amp;mdash; ∮∮∮ &amp;mdash;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;blockquote&gt;&lt;p&gt;Mayor Dwight C. Jones and the City's Public Art Commission (PAC) announced today a new monument commemorating Maggie L. Walker that will be created by artist Antonio Tobias &quot;Toby&quot; Mendez. The Public Art Commission worked with a Site Selection team of neighborhood leaders and stakeholders to choose the artist and the location that would best reflect the important legacy of Maggie L. Walker and her contributions to the City of Richmond. The monument will be integrated into a new plaza and gathering space on Broad Street at North Adams Street.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;The Maggie L. Walker monument will become embedded as a landmark in the City's Downtown Arts District. &quot;Not only will Richmond gain an important new monument that can reflect the diverse heritage and history of a significant local hero, but this effort will also underscore her role as a champion for civil rights on the national landscape,&quot; said Mayor Jones. &quot;Maggie Walker was a revolutionary leader in business, a champion for breaking down barriers between communities and showed incredible strength as a person that came out of extraordinarily challenging circumstances to create great things.&quot;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;Maggie L. Walker devoted her life to civil rights advancement during the Jim Crow-era. Maggie Walker's home and business -- where she broke ground as the first woman of any race to found a bank -- are located within walking distance of the planned monument site. The downtown Broad Street location is also symbolic as that corridor once served as a divider between historically racially segregated neighborhoods. The new monument, targeted for completion in the fall of 2016, will serve as a gateway to the historic Jackson Ward community and the new home of the Black History Museum and Cultural Center of Virginia at the historic Leigh Street Armory.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;The Public Art Commission led an extensive community process that asked the public what elements of Maggie Walker's life should be reflected in the art work. The images of her strength, perseverance and dedication to empower and educate were all consistent themes that will be reflected in the new monument.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;Artist Toby Mendez said, &quot;I see my role as a story teller or a director in search of a good story. I have had the luck to create monuments to Thurgood Marshall and Gandhi. Maggie Walker is in that realm, a person who did so many great things. Her story is not just one story as she was a pioneer on several levels; a business person, a banker, a teacher and an innovator when it came to creating significant jobs for women in the community. She did this with every stumbling block placed in her path. As an artist, this is the story you want to tell.&quot;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;Sarah Driggs, chair of the Maggie Walker Memorial team of the Public Art Commission shared that, &quot;Richmond has been proud of Maggie Walker for generations. While we wait for more info to trickle in, let's sit and stare in awe at the $303,641 raised by Levar Stoney &lt;em&gt;in the first reporting period&lt;/em&gt;. To put that in context: Mayor Jones spent &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.vpap.org/offices/richmond-city-mayor/elections/?year_and_type=2016regular&quot;&gt;$314,499&lt;/a&gt; in all of 2012 (running unopposed, of course)! Mayoral candidates in 2008 spent between &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.vpap.org/offices/richmond-city-mayor/elections/?year_and_type=2012regular&quot;&gt;$400,000 - $500,000&lt;/a&gt;, and Wilder spent &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.vpap.org/offices/richmond-city-mayor/elections/?year_and_type=2004regular&quot;&gt;$277,897&lt;/a&gt; in 2004. What all that means, I think, is that Stoney has taken Richmond's mayoral race to the next level. Half a million bucks might no longer be enough to get it done. This means doughnuts are weirder, maybe free, and you'll have to stand in line longer to get one than any other day of the year. &lt;a href=&quot;https://www.facebook.com/SugarShackDonuts/posts/912172588905540&quot;&gt;Sugar Shack&lt;/a&gt; and &lt;a href=&quot;https://www.facebook.com/duckdonuts.richmond/posts/716754335134501&quot;&gt;Duck Donuts&lt;/a&gt; have some deals you may want to check out. &lt;a href=&quot;https://www.facebook.com/earlybirdbiscuitco/photos/a.788469841192536.1073741828.787115894661264/1164270133612503/?type=3&amp;amp;theater&quot;&gt;Early Bird Biscuit will have a doughnut biscuit&lt;/a&gt;?!&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;The Commonwealth Institute released &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.thecommonwealthinstitute.org/2016/06/01/weighing-support-for-virginias-students/&quot;&gt;a report detailing the lack of state-level funding Virginia provides to its low-income public school students&lt;/a&gt;. Richmond has a much higher percentage (for now) of low-income students than its neighbors, so underfunding in this way impacts Richmond more and is one of the reasons why comparing Richmond to Chesterfield / Henrico is not super fair. The report says that if funding levels had been raised by the General Assembly, RPS would have seen $10 million more this fiscal year. We can argue about the mayor's $500,000 security detail all we want, but that's pennies compared to an extra ten million bucks from the state--which would have gone a &lt;em&gt;long&lt;/em&gt; way to closing RPS's $18 million budget gap. State funding accounts for 36% of the 2016-2017 general fund revenue for Richmond Public Schools. That's almost $100,000,000. If we want to truly fund our public schools, we've got to start working on state-level policy, too.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;Here's an article about a weird / interesting thing: &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.richmond.com/news/local/chesterfield/article_92579489-323f-578a-bc6b-9b4b970e1e71.html&quot;&gt;an &quot;adventure park and lifestyle center&quot; in Chesterfield County&lt;/a&gt;.
